Calming Exercises for Women
Calming exercises for women are activities that help relax and build mental strength. Here are some effective techniques:
- Mindful Breathing: Focus on your breath, taking deep and slow inhalations followed by gentle exhalations. This technique calms the mind and centers your thoughts.
- Body Awareness: Conduct a body scan from head to toe, identifying areas of tension and consciously relaxing those muscles.
- Loving-Kindness Meditation: Send compassionate thoughts to yourself and others, which can enhance self-talk and improve your mood.
- Gratitude Journaling: Write down three things you are grateful for each day to cultivate a positive mindset and promote emotional resilience.

Stress Relief for Women Through Meditation
For many women, meditation is a game-changer for stress relief. It offers both physical and mental benefits. Studies by Dr. Sara Lazar and others show that meditation lowers cortisol, heart rate, and inflammation.
These changes come from the body’s relaxation response. It fights chronic stress, affecting sleep and heart health.
